摘要
The temperature variation of the K-39 and H-2 nuclear quadrupole coupling constants e2 qQ/h and eta in KOH and KOD have been measured from high field NMR powder patterns over a temperature range centered on the antiferroelectric transition for each compound. The temperature variation of T1 for H-2 in KOD exhibits a sharp minimum at the transition. The precipitous variation of the coupling at T(c) confirms both transitions as first order. The implications of the data for the deuteron (hydrogen) motion above the transition is discussed.
